# Internal function that plots the data
#
# This function is intended to be used within the package. For details refer to
# \code{\link{screenIsotopeData}}. Is planned to deprecate it in the near
# future.
#
# @param isotopeData a named list composed at least of 6 vectors, dNb1, dCb1,
# dCc, dNc, deltaN and deltaC
# @param type character that states if an "histogram" or a "density" will be
# ploted.
#
#
screenIsotopeData1source <- function (isotopeData = NULL, type = "histogram") {
# Stupid CRAN fix for variables - see here http://stackoverflow.com/questions/
# 9439256/how-can-i-handle-r-cmd-check-no-visible-binding-for-global-variable-
# notes-when
# As seen in https://github.com/andrewcparnell/simmr/blob/master/R/plot.simmr_
# output.R
d15N <- Factor <- NULL
if (!is.null(isotopeData)){
if (type == "histogram"){
if (min(isotopeData$dNb1) < min(isotopeData$dNc)) {
xlimMin <- min(isotopeData$dNb1)
} else {
xlimMin <- min(isotopeData$dNc)
}
if (max(isotopeData$dNc) > max(isotopeData$dNb1)) {
xlimMax <- max(isotopeData$dNc)
} else {
xlimMax <- max(isotopeData$dNb1)
}
extra <- abs(xlimMax - xlimMin) * 0.3
if (length(isotopeData$dNb1) >= length(isotopeData$dNc)) {
graphics::hist(isotopeData$dNb1, xlim = c(xlimMin - extra, xlimMax +
extra),
col = grDevices::rgb(0, 1, 0,0.5),
xlab = "isotopic value of nitrogen",
main = "Basic histogram of baseline (green)\n and consumer (red)")
graphics::hist(isotopeData$dNc, col = grDevices::rgb(1, 0, 0,0.5),
add = TRUE)
} else {
graphics::hist(isotopeData$dNc, xlim = c(xlimMin - extra, xlimMax +
extra),
col = grDevices::rgb(1, 0, 0,0.5),
xlab = "isotopic value of nitrogen",
main = "Basic histogram of baseline (green)\n and consumer (red)")
graphics::hist(isotopeData$dNb1, col = grDevices::rgb(0, 1, 0,0.5),
add = TRUE)
}
} else if (type == "density") {
df <- toStacked(isotopeData)
ggplot2::ggplot(df, ggplot2::aes(x = d15N, colour = Factor,
fill = Factor)) +
ggplot2::geom_density(alpha=0.7) +
ggplot2::theme_bw() +
ggplot2::xlab(expression(paste(delta^{15}, "N (\u2030)"))) +
ggplot2::coord_flip()
}
}
}
